Habitat for Humanity launching Scarborough project
The 13-house, 20-acre development will include homes offered through the Habitat program and through the Scarborough Housing Alliance.

South Portland, Portland schools get STEM funds
SOUTH PORTLAND — Texas Instruments has announced it will provide $150,000 in multi-year “Power of STEM” grants to the South Portland and Portland school departments. The three-year grants will be split between the state’s two largest school districts to support a science-technology-engineering-mathematics academy for students in both cities.
